html,body {
	margin: 0;
	padding: 0;
}

table {
	width: 100%;
	height: 100%;
}

td {
	vertical-align: top;
	text-align: center;
}

div {
	border: 0px;
}

div.container {
	position: relative;
	text-align: left;
	margin-left: auto;
	margin-right: auto;
	width: 780px;
	height: 432px;
}

div.rsHdr {
	position: absolute;
	top: 18px;
	left: 157px;
	width: 394px;
	height: 58px;
}

div.navBarLineTop {
	position: absolute;
	top: 83px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.navBar {
	position: absolute;
	top: 100px;
	left: 19px;
	width: 740px;
	height: 28px;
}

div.navBarLineBottom {
	position: absolute;
	top: 131px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.bobLeft {
	position: absolute;
	top: 282px;
	left: 13px;
	width: 200px;
	height: 304px;
}

div.bobCenter {
	position: absolute;
	top: 182px;
	left: 231px;
	width: 325px;
	height: 302px;
}

div.bobRight {
	position: absolute;
	top: 302px;
	left: 574px;
	width: 190px;
	height: 240px;
}

div.mainContent {
	position: absolute;
	top: 160px;
	left: 10px;
	width: 760px;
	height: 100%;
	font-family :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	padding-bottom : 15px;
	padding-left : 10px;
	padding-right : 10px;
	padding-top : 5px;
	font-size : 16px;
}

div.lineBottomHome {
	position: absolute;
	top: 620px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.lineBottomResume {
	position: absolute;
	top: 875px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.lineBottomBooks {
	position: absolute;
	top: 680px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.lineBottomLectures {
	position: absolute;
	top: 1600px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.lineBottomContact {
	position: absolute;
	top: 340px;
	left: 0px;
	width: 780px;
	height: 6px;
}

div.contentHdrsPosResume {
	position: absolute;
	top: 5px;
	left: 330px;
	width: 190px;
	height: 20px;
}

div.contentHdrsPosBooks {
	position: absolute;
	top: 5px;
	left: 338px;
	width: 190px;
	height: 20px;
}

div.contentHdrsPosLectures {
	position: absolute;
	top: 5px;
	left: 290px;
	width: 190px;
	height: 20px;
}

div.contentHdrsPosContact {
	position: absolute;
	top: 5px;
	left: 290px;
	width: 190px;
	height: 20px;
}

.contentHdrs {
	font-size : 25px;
	font-weight : bold;
}

div.copyrightHome{
	position: absolute;
	top: 700px;
	left: 264px;
	width: 265px;
	height: 60px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	font-style : normal;
	color: #FFFFFF;
}

div.copyrightResume {
	position: absolute;
	top: 950px;
	left: 264px;
	width: 290px;
	height: 60px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	font-style : normal;
	color: #FFFFFF;
}

div.copyrightBooks{
	position: absolute;
	top: 760px;
	left: 264px;
	width: 265px;
	height: 60px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	font-style : normal;
	color: #FFFFFF;
}

div.copyrightLectures{
	position: absolute;
	top: 1680px;
	left: 264px;
	width: 265px;
	height: 60px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	font-style : normal;
	color: #FFFFFF;
}

div.copyrightContact{
	position: absolute;
	top: 420px;
	left: 264px;
	width: 265px;
	height: 60px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	font-style : normal;
	color: #FFFFFF;
}


div.textNavHome {
	position: absolute;
	top: 650px;
	left: 230px;
	width: 330px;
	height: 30px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 12px;
	font-style : normal;
	color: #FFFFFF;
}

div.textNavResume {
	position: absolute;
	top: 905px;
	left: 230px;
	width: 330px;
	height: 30px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 12px;
	font-style : normal;
	color: #FFFFFF;
}

div.textNavBooks {
	position: absolute;
	top: 710px;
	left: 230px;
	width: 330px;
	height: 30px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 12px;
	font-style : normal;
	color: #FFFFFF;
}
 
div.textNavLectures {
	position: absolute;
	top: 1630px;
	left: 230px;
	width: 330px;
	height: 30px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 12px;
	font-style : normal;
	color: #FFFFFF;
}

div.textNavContact {
	position: absolute;
	top: 370px;
	left: 230px;
	width: 330px;
	height: 30px;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 12px;
	font-style : normal;
	color: #FFFFFF;
}
 

A {
	color: #FFFFFF;
}

A:HOVER {
	color: #CCCCCC;
}

div.womenTurmoil {
	position: absolute;
	top: 55px;
	left: 162px;
	width: 126px;
	height: 182px;
}

div.furiousLesbian {
	position: absolute;
	top: 55px;
	left: 315px;
	width: 126px;
	height: 191px;
}

div.shatteredApplause {
	position: absolute;
	top: 55px;
	left: 469px;
	width: 126px;
	height: 191px;
}

div.stagingDesire {
	position: absolute;
	top: 55px;
	left: 623px;
	width: 126px;
	height: 191px;
}

div.passingPerf {
	position: absolute;
	top: 300px;
	left: 10px;
	width: 126px;
	height: 191px;
}

div.evaBioBib {
	position: absolute;
	top: 300px;
	left: 212px;
	width: 126px;
	height: 191px;
}

div.ibsenAmerica {
	position: absolute;
	top: 300px;
	left: 417px;
	width: 126px;
	height: 191px;
}

div.theatricalLegacy {
	position: absolute;
	top: 300px;
	left: 623px;
	width: 126px;
	height: 191px;
}

div.bobLecturing4{
	position: absolute;
	top: 300px;
	left: 530px;
	width: 200px;
	height: 288px;
}

div.bobLecturing5{
	position: absolute;
	top: 960px;
	left: 450px;
	width: 200px;
	height: 274px;
}

div.contactName{
	position: absolute;
	top: 100px;
	left: 20px;
	width: 100px;
	height: 50px;
}

div.contactEmail{
	position: absolute;
	top: 100px;
	left: 300px;
	width: 100px;
	height: 50px;
}

div.contactMessage{
	position: absolute;
	top: 200px;
	left: 20px;
	width: 100px;
	height: 200px;
}

div.contactButtons{
	position: absolute;
	top: 440px;
	left: 20px;
	width: 200px;
	height: 100px;
}

.contactFormField{
	border-color : #FFFFFF;
	background-color : #000000;
	border : 1 px;
	border-style : solid;
	font-family :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	scrollbar-base-color : Black;
	scrollbar-arrow-color : #FFFFFF;
	scrollbar-3dlight-color : #FFFFFF;
	scrollbar-shadow-color : #FFFFFF;
}

.contactFormButtons{
	background-color : #000000;
	border : #FFFFFF solid;
	font-family :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	border-bottom : 1 px;
	border-left : 1 px;
	border-right : 1 px;
	border-top : 1 px;
}
.angels {
	position: absolute;
	top: 55px;
	left: 10px;
	width: 126px;
	height: 240px;
	font-size: 12px;
	font-weight: normal;
	text-align: center;

}
.angelsBig {
	height: 300px;
	width: 200px;
	left: 10px;
	top: 20px;
	position: absolute;

}
.angelsTextTop {
	height: 300px;
	width: 500px;
	left: 230px;
	top: 20px;
	position: absolute;

}
.mainContentSpecial {

	position: absolute;
	top: 110px;
	left: 10px;
	width: 760px;
	height: 100%;
	font-family :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	padding-bottom : 15px;
	padding-left : 10px;
	padding-right : 10px;
	padding-top : 5px;
	font-size : 16px;
}
.angelsEssaysList {

	height: 30px;
	width: 130px;
	left: 150px;
	top: 350px;
	position: absolute;
}
.angelsReadReviews {


	height: 30px;
	width: 150px;
	left: 450px;
	top: 350px;
	position: absolute;
}
.angelsTextBottom {

	height: 800px;
	width: 735px;
	left: 10px;
	top: 400px;
	position: absolute;
}
